TIRE AND WHEEL SYSTEM INSPECTION

CAUTION / NOTICE / HINT

Note

When replacing a tire or tire valve, it is not necessary to remove the wheel cap.

PROCEDURE


  1. INSPECT TIRES


    1. Inspect the tires for wear and proper inflation pressure.

      Cold Tire Inflation Pressure
      Tire Size Cold Tire Inflation Pressure
      Front Rear
      235/65R18 106V

      260 kPa (2.6 kgf/cm2, 38 psi)*1

      230 kPa (2.3 kgf/cm2, 33 psi)*2, *3

      250 kPa (2.5 kgf/cm2, 36 psi)*2, *4

      235/55R20 102V

      300 kPa (3.0 kgf/cm2, 44 psi)*1

      230 kPa (2.3 kgf/cm2, 33 psi)*2

      *1: For driving at 160 km/h (100 mph) or over

      *2: For driving under 160 km/h (100 mph)

      *3: for China, Latin America and Korea

      *4: except China, Latin America and Korea

      Cold Tire Inflation Pressure (for Compact Spare Tire)
      Tire Size Cold Tire Inflation Pressure
      T165/90D18 107M

      420 kPa (4.2 kgf/cm2, 60 psi)

      2. Tire pressure adjustment method when warm:


        1. Turn the engine switch off.

        2. Connect the GTS to the DLC3.

        3. Turn the engine switch on (IG).

        4. Turn the GTS on.

        5. Enter the following menus: Chassis / Tire Pressure Monitor / Data List.

        6. Adjust the tire pressure so that the displayed value is equal to the set pressure.

        7. Perform initialization and check that initialization completes.

        8. Check and record the value of the Data List item "Temperature in Tire". (Ts)

        9. Check and record the ambient temperature during tire pressure adjustment. (Tm)

        10. Readjust the tire pressure according to the difference between the tire internal temperature (Ts) and the ambient temperature (Tm). (P)

          Tech Tips

          Tire internal temperature: Ts, Ambient temperature: Tm, Tire pressure readjustment value: P

          P = (Specified Pressure) + (Ts - Tm)

        11. Check the pressure adjustment value with the Data List item "Tire Inflation Pressure".

        Note

        for ECE-R64 Type:

        If the tire pressure is decreased approximately 20 kPa (0.2 kgf/cm2, 2.9 psi) or more in order to adjust the tire pressure, even if the adjusted tire pressure is 80% or more than the tire pressure set during system initialization, the tire pressure warning light may illuminate if the tire pressure drops below 80% of the tire pressure set when the tires are warmed. In this case, perform initialization again.

    2. A01VV5X

      Using a dial indicator, check the runout of the tires.

      Maximum Tire Runout
      1.4 mm (0.0551 in.)

      Tech Tips

      Measure the runout with the wheel assembly removed from the vehicle.

  3. INSPECT AND ADJUST WHEEL BALANCE


    1. A01VVH0C01
      *a 25 mm (0.984 in.)

      Inspect and adjust the off-the-car balance.

      Maximum Wheel Imbalance
      8.0 g (0.0176 lb)

      Note


      • Use a cleaning detergent to remove dirt, oil and water from the surface where the balance weight is to be adhered.

      • Do not touch the adhesive surface of the balance weight.

      • Adhere a stick-on type balance weight to the flat surface*a shown in the illustration.

      • Push the balance weight with your finger to securely adhere it to the desired position.

      • Do not reuse balance weights.

      • Use only LEXUS genuine stick-on type balance weights or equivalent.

      Tech Tips


      • Use clip-on type balance weights for the inner side, and stick-on type balance weights for the outer side.

      • If the tires vibrate even after the off-the-car balance adjustment, adjust the wheel balance with on-the-car balancing as necessary.
